У меня есть Баш скрипт, который отправляет много рабочих мест в кластер, это выглядит примерно так:Как записать идентификатор процесса задания (ы), запущенный в Баш скрипт
for i in `seq 1 ${MIN}`
do
cd longjob_${i}/
make
nohup ./prog.x &
done
prog.x
является Фортран исполняемым. Я хотел бы записать pid каждой работы, так что я мог бы убить при желании задания по мере необходимости. Есть ли способ сделать это, например, записать номер pid в файл nohup.out
?
возможно дубликат [Получить PID процесса начался с поЬирами через SSH] (http://stackoverflow.com/ вопросы/12647382/get-the-pid-of-a-process-start-with-nohup-through-ssh) –